Cape Breton Regional Municipality developed a Disaster Debris Management Plan to guide how debris is removed, recycled, and responsibly managed after severe weather or other emergency events. The plan strengthens municipal preparedness, supports climate adaptation, and reduces environmental impacts by integrating sustainable debris-handling practices, ecosystem restoration, and emissions reduction considerations into daily operations. Designed to be shareable with other municipalities across the province, it also provides clear procedures, guidelines, and templates that can help build broader community resilience in the face of increasingly severe climate related events.
